Welcome to Philosophy and Beliefs at Hayesfield. We are an experienced and enthusiastic team and love exploring all issues related to Philosophy and Beliefs. Philosophy and Beliefs is taught in the Lower School, from Year 7 to Year 9. Students can opt to take Religious Studies as a GCSE option in Year 10, either as the full course or as a short course. Philosophy and Ethics as an A Level option offered in our Sixth Form.

Overview of the Philosophy and Beliefs Curriculum ay Hayesfield:
The Philosophy and Beliefs curriculum is divided into 3 key areas:
Lower School – 3 year bridging curriculum from KS2 to GCSE (Year 7 to Year 9)
Upper School – 2 Year GCSE course in Year 10 and Year 11
Sixth Form – 2 Year A Level course in Year 12 and Year 13
